Sticky Notes is an application text note that can be created on dashboard in MacBook. Just like on Windows system, Mac users have also been benefitted to create notes of text marking on MacBook to help keep reminders of something that users need to do.

Sticky Note can be created with simple steps as mentioned here:

Go to dashboard on dock or go to Finder. Choose Applications and select Stickies app. Stickies will get displayed in dock. Double-click on it to open. Type required text, if necessary you can change the color of a note with the help of Color option in its menu bar. And to alter fonts of typed text go to Font menu. You can create as many Sticky notes as you wish by clicking on New Note in Edit menu.
